Moped crash causes broken arm; man leaves scene on footTualatin OR

audio iconTraffic
SW Port Orford St, Tualatin, OR 97062

An adult male crashed his moped near Central 60th Avenue and Port Orford Street. He suffered a visibly broken arm and left the scene on foot, calling for help. The man appeared to be with a child, possibly his daughter. He was last seen heading toward his daughter's residence near Port Orford Street.
